Output 266c4ba7ce017953f2d73fef7c24ef18517d617ecb57b5a1bdf576e4eab2c221:79

value
399699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e921b6d680ecc01b75dbe79a6fcd012f3894f13 OP_EQUAL
address
3BmfHM5fVwE1UCENFc5jCRKznXPBoHsixZ
transaction
266c4ba7ce017953f2d73fef7c24ef18517d617ecb57b5a1bdf576e4eab2c221
confirmations
425083
spent
true